ANJALI HIT AND RUN CASE: ONE MORE ACCUSED ARRESTED , ONE STILL AT LARGE

Face2News/New Delhi

(MOREPIC1)In Sultanpuri case,  police reported to have arrested sixth accused Ashutosh who had given false information to the police. The seventh accused is still at large and major hunt to nab  the accused is going on. 

Mr. Sagar Preet Hooda, IPS, Special CP/ Law & Order, Zone IIm said earlier a Delhi court on Thursday sent all five arrested accused to four-day police custody in the Kanjhawala accident case. The police had asked for five days remand. On being asked by the court the reason behind five days police custody, the investigating officer said, “We have taken CCTV footage from petrol pump, restaurant where they ate food during the three days police custody remand.

They visited various places, its almost a 13 km route. We have to confront them with each other as well. It’s a long route and that of all accused persons is to be studied. It is also necessary to arrest other two accused persons.”

Call Detail Record (CDR) has confirmed that both victim Anjali and her friend Nidhi met at a Rohini metro station around 6-7 pm on the day of incident. It has been established that they were together till the time of accident as their location is same. The CDR has also confirmed that none of the women had ever contacted five of the arrested men.  Further investigation is on.

Meanwhile Delhi Commission for Women (DCW) chief Swati Maliwal has suggested the Centre to transfer the Sultanpuri accident case to the Central Bureau of Investigation (CBI).
